HC set aside order removing Board of Directors of society
Kochi, Jan 24 (UNI) The Kerala High Court today set aside the order of Registrar of Co-operatives removing the Board of Directors of the Kannur Co-opearative Society that govern the Pariyaram Medical College and hospital.
The Court passed the order after hearing three writ petitions filed by Society Chairman and former Minister M V Raghavan and Mr C T Ahammed Ali.
Mr Justice J M James observed that the reason given for removing the Board of Directors was not sustainable. The Registrar of Co-operatives issued the order on December 22 on the ground that the Board lacked sufficient quorum to conduct its meeting.
The Court found that the Board had sufficient quorum as per the Society's Bye-law and the Co-operative Society's Act.
The Court also ordered that the Board of Directors should be reinstated to conduct the affairs of the Society.
